Esbjerg sits on the Jutland peninsula’s west coast, where the North Sea meets Denmark’s accessible urban amenities. It is a functional hub for exploring the west coast, teasing out day trips to historic Ribe, the dramatic Wadden Sea coast, and inland attractions that delight both kids and adults. Local Experiences and Things to Do in Esbjerg

One of the pleasures of choosing Esbjerg as a destination is the abundance of activities that fit a varied pace and interest. From outdoor adventures to cultural immersion, there are plenty of local experiences and things to do that suit a family‑friendly, socially engaged holiday. Here’s a curated sense of what you can plan around your accommodation in Esbjerg:

  • Harbor strolls and waterfront dining: Enjoy fresh seafood and views of fishing boats returning at dusk, a quintessentially Danish experience that pairs perfectly with a relaxed “stay in” evening after a day of exploration.
  • Fisheries and Maritime Museum: This popular attraction offers interactive exhibits and insights into Denmark’s rich coastal heritage, making it a great family day out that combines learning with fun.
  • Art and culture: Esbjerg Art Museum and nearby galleries provide a compact cultural circuit where contemporary Danish photography, painting, and sculpture can be appreciated in an afternoon.
  • Iconic sculpture trail: The “Men at the Sea” statues near the harbor create a memorable photo stop and offer an accessible outdoor experience for visitors of all ages.
  • Outdoor adventures on the coast: With the Wadden Sea’s unique ecosystem nearby, opportunities for walking, birdwatching, and light hiking tempt Nature lovers who want a restorative break in the fresh sea breeze.
  • Day trips to Ribe and beyond: A short drive or train ride to Ribe—Denmark’s oldest town—delivers medieval charm, a cathedral, cobblestones, and a delightful village atmosphere. It’s a wonderful complement to a stay in Esbjerg for travelers who crave varied experiences.
  • Bike friendly explorations: Esbjerg’s flat terrain and well‑maintained bike lanes invite families to cycle between neighborhoods, beaches, and parks, turning a day of sightseeing into an active adventure with less stress on little legs.
  • Food markets and bakeries: Seasonal markets and local bakeries provide an opportunity to sample Danish pastries, rye bread, and regional staples that enhance a “holiday accommodation” experience with authentic flavors.

Practical Information for Your Esbjerg Stay

Before you travel, keep this practical guide in mind to optimize your experience while you’re in Esbjerg:

  • Currency and payments: Denmark uses the Danish krone. Many places accept cards, but it’s wise to have a small amount of cash for markets or small vendors.
  • Language: Danish is the official language, but English is commonly spoken in tourist areas and by many hosts and service providers.
  • Weather and packing: The West Jutland coast can be breezy and cool, even in summer. Pack light layers, a windbreaker, and comfortable walking shoes for day trips to Ribe or along the harbor.
  • Safety: Esbjerg is a safe city with well‑maintained streets and reliable public services. As with any travel, keep travel documents secure and follow local guidance for transportation and outdoor activities.
  • Connectivity: Most accommodations provide Wi‑Fi; check the speed if you plan to work remotely or stream entertainment during downtime.
  • Transport: Consider renting a car for day trips to Ribe, the Wadden Sea, or coastal beaches, though the city is also workable by bike and bus routes for local exploration.
